Clutch Kit for the 2012 BMW X3: What It Does and How to Keep It in Top Shape
The 2012 BMW X3 is a versatile SUV that combines luxury with performance, and when it comes to manual transmission versions, the clutch kit plays an essential role. If you own a 2012 BMW X3 with a manual gearbox, you should know that a clutch kit is definitely relevant and vital for smooth, reliable driving. This component is not just a simple part, it is actually a combination of several crucial pieces that work together to ensure the vehicle shifts gears efficiently and without any hassle.
A clutch kit usually includes the clutch disc, pressure plate, release bearing, and sometimes an alignment tool. These components are designed to work in harmony to transfer power from the engine to the transmission. When the clutch pedal is pressed, the clutch disengages, allowing the driver to change gears without grinding or causing damage to the gearbox. When released, the clutch re-engages, allowing power to flow through the drivetrain and propel the vehicle forward.
For the 2012 BMW X3, the clutch kit is a wear-and-tear item just like brake pads or tyres. Even though BMW builds these vehicles with quality parts that are designed to last, over time, the clutch components will inevitably wear down due to the friction involved. This wear can lead to issues like slipping clutches, difficulty changing gears, or strange noises. That's why keeping an eye on the clutch's condition and knowing when to replace the clutch kit is important for any manual transmission BMW X3 owner.
Replacing the clutch kit is a job best left to professionals given the technical knowledge required and the need for specialised tools. The process involves removing the transmission, which can be a bit of a mission, but the reward is restoring your X3's smooth gear changes and driving comfort. The parts inside the clutch kit typically wear out as a set, so it makes practical sense to replace them all at once rather than piecemeal repairs. This practice can save time and money down the track by preventing further clutch issues.
Maintenance-wise, there are a couple of tips that can help extend the life of your clutch kit. Avoid riding the clutch pedal, which is when you rest your foot lightly on the pedal all the time, as this causes unnecessary friction and speeds up wear. Also, try to avoid keeping the clutch partially engaged in traffic or on hills for prolonged periods. Gentle and deliberate use can go a long way to preserving clutch health.
Because the 2012 BMW X3 is a premium vehicle, using the correct, OEM-standard clutch kits is critical to maintain drivability and performance. Cheaper or non-approved components might save some dollars initially but can cause poor performance, quicker wear, and even damage to other parts. Quality clutch kits are engineered to exact specifications to handle the power and torque output of the X3's engines and deliver consistent operation.
When it's time to assess or replace the clutch kit on a 2012 BMW X3, it's worth keeping an eye on symptoms such as a spongy or sticking clutch pedal, slipping under acceleration, difficulty shifting gears, or unusual noises when engaging the clutch. These are tell-tale signs that the clutch kit components are ready for service or replacement. Getting on top of these issues early will save a headache and avoid more costly repairs down the track.
Servicing intervals for clutch kits will vary depending on your driving style and conditions. Aggressive driving, towing, or city stop-start traffic can lead to faster clutch wear, while steady highway driving might allow longer service intervals. Regular inspections as part of your scheduled BMW service will help keep tabs on clutch condition and overall transmission health.
In short, the clutch kit plays a fundamental role in keeping the 2012 BMW X3 running smoothly if it's a manual model. Knowing what a clutch kit involves, what signs to look for, and how to maintain it can make the difference between smooth sailing and sudden inconvenience on the road. With proper care and timely replacement, the clutch kit will help maintain the performance and driving experience that BMW is known for.
